- The distance between Lord Howe Island, Australia and Jakarta, Java, Indonesia is approximately 6,104 km or 3,793 mi.
- To reach Lord Howe Island in this distance one would set out from Jakarta, Java bearing 124.6°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Lord Howe Island bearing 106.1° or ESE .
- Lord Howe Island has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Jakarta, Java has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- The annual average temperature is 8.3 °C (15°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.6 °C (10.1°F) more in Lord Howe Island.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 256.4 mm (10.1 in) less which is equivalent to 256.4 l/m² (6.29 US gal/ft²) or 2,564,000 l/ha (274,109 US gal/ac) less. About 6/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16.2° lower in Lord Howe Island than in Jakarta, Java.
